Summary
With over 30 years as a ceramicist and sculptor, I have demonstrated proficiency as a functional potter and skilled sculptor in a wide variety of materials. I specialize in the use of various clay bodies and techniques to bring out the natural beauty of the materials to create functional and decorative pieces. My figurative sculpture is inspired by our natural world, and my pieces begin in oil and water-based clays with a target medium in mind, including plaster, resins, clay, and stone. I have a mastery of the materials and tools used in the creation process, including mold making and casting, with skills in the pointing method for stone carving.

Projects
Project Eleven, Plein-Air Sculpting - Clay Sculpting
January 2026 - March 2027
Project Eleven: A Journey of Art, Place, and Connection https://ajinspirations.life/project-eleven
  • Project Eleven is an immersive artistic adventure blending exploration with sculpture. By engaging deeply with a city’s culture or a natural landscape, we capture the essence of "place" through walking.
  • More than a studio practice, it’s a shared experience. Over months, we involve the community via live plein-air sculpting, behind-the-scenes documentation, and on-site studies. The journey ends in a gallery exhibition—a contemplative space that inspires wonder and reflection on our impact within the community and environment.
